excel公式显示0显示结果
作者:百问excel教程网
|
198人看过
发布时间:2026-03-08 01:45:12
当您在Excel中输入公式却只得到数字0时,这通常意味着公式本身在语法上是正确的,但计算结果就是零,或者数据源、单元格格式、引用方式存在问题。要解决“excel公式显示0显示结果”的困扰,核心在于系统性地排查公式逻辑、数据源的真实数值、单元格的数字格式以及函数参数设置,通过调整计算选项、检查空白与空值、修正引用错误等方法,即可让公式显示出预期的计算结果。
在日常使用Excel处理数据时,您可能遇到过这样的情景:满心期待地在单元格中输入一个精心构思的公式,按下回车后,得到的却不是预想中的数字或文本,而是一个孤零零的“0”。这个小小的“0”就像一个沉默的谜题,让人不禁疑惑:是我的公式写错了吗?还是数据有问题?今天,我们就来深入探讨这个常见的“excel公式显示0显示结果”现象,系统地剖析其背后可能的原因,并提供一套完整、实用的排查与解决方案。 为什么我的Excel公式只显示0,而不显示计算结果? 首先,我们需要理解一个基本概念:在Excel中,公式显示为0,本身并不等同于公式“出错”。Excel的公式错误通常会以“DIV/0!”、“VALUE!”、“N/A”等明显的错误值来提示。当单元格规规矩矩地显示为0时,往往意味着公式本身在语法层面被Excel认可并成功执行了计算,但最终的运算结果恰好就是数值0。因此,我们的排查思路应从“为什么结果会是0”出发,而非简单认为公式无效。 最常见的原因之一是参与计算的数据本身即为0或空白。例如,公式“=A1B1”,如果A1或B1中有一个是0,或者两者都是空白(Excel默认将空白单元格在某些计算中视作0),那么结果自然是0。这时,您需要双击单元格,确认源数据的真实内容。有时单元格看似空白,实则可能包含不可见的空格字符,这可以通过“清除格式”或使用“查找和替换”功能将空格替换为空来检查。 单元格的数字格式设置是另一个关键因素。如果您将单元格格式预先设置为“数字”、“货币”或“会计专用”等,但实际输入的是文本型数字或公式,Excel可能会将其显示为0。例如,在一个格式为“数值”且小数位数为0的单元格中,输入公式“=0.5+0.3”,由于计算结果0.8被四舍五入显示,您看到的就会是1(而非0)。但更典型的场景是,如果单元格被意外设置为“文本”格式,那么您输入的任何公式都将被当作普通文本显示,在默认对齐方式下,文本左对齐,有时会显示为公式本身而非结果;但在某些情况下,也可能被显示为0。解决方法是选中单元格,在“开始”选项卡的“数字”组中,将格式更改为“常规”或“数值”,然后重新激活公式(双击单元格进入编辑状态,直接按回车即可)。 Excel的“公式”计算选项也可能导致此问题。请点击“文件”->“选项”->“公式”,检查“计算选项”部分。如果“工作簿计算”被设置为“手动”,那么当您更改了公式引用的数据后,公式结果不会自动更新,可能会保持上一次计算的结果(可能是0)。将其改为“自动”,Excel就会在数据变动时实时重算公式。此外,勾选“启用迭代计算”也可能影响某些循环引用的公式结果,通常不建议普通用户开启。 函数使用不当是产生0结果的深层原因之一。以常用的“VLOOKUP”函数为例,如果您使用该函数查找某个值,但查找区域的第一列中不存在完全匹配项,并且您将第四个参数“range_lookup”设置为“FALSE”(精确匹配),函数将返回“N/A”错误。但如果您设置为“TRUE”(近似匹配,或省略该参数),且查找值小于查找区域第一列中的最小值,函数就可能返回0或其他非预期值。因此,务必检查函数参数的意义和设置是否正确。 类似地,在使用“SUMIF”、“COUNTIF”等条件求和或计数函数时,如果条件范围或求和范围设置错误,或者条件本身与数据不匹配,函数就可能对“空集”进行计算,结果返回0。例如,“=SUMIF(A:A, "苹果", B:B)”会在A列中寻找“苹果”,并对对应的B列数值求和。如果A列中没有“苹果”,那么求和结果就是0。 单元格引用错误,特别是跨工作表或工作簿引用时链接失效,也会导致公式结果为0。如果您引用了另一个工作表或外部工作簿的单元格,而那个源文件被移动、重命名或删除,那么引用就会变成无效链接。Excel通常会尝试保留最后一次已知的值,但有时也会显示为0。您可以检查公式中是否包含类似“[外部文件名]工作表名!单元格”的引用,并确保所有被引用的文件都已打开且路径正确。 数组公式的运用需要特别注意。在旧版Excel中,数组公式需要按“Ctrl+Shift+Enter”组合键输入,公式两侧会出现大括号“”。如果仅按回车,公式可能无法正确计算,有时会只返回第一个元素或显示0。在新版的Microsoft 365 Excel中,动态数组公式已简化此过程,但如果您在使用旧版或特定函数时,仍需确认输入方式是否正确。 隐藏的行、列或筛选状态下的数据,可能会影响求和、平均值等聚合函数的计算结果。例如,您对一列数据使用“SUBTOTAL”函数进行求和,但该列中有行被隐藏或处于筛选后不可见状态,函数会根据其功能代码决定是否包含这些隐藏值。如果使用了忽略隐藏值的代码,而所有可见单元格的值恰好都是0或空白,结果就会显示0。这并非错误,而是函数在按您(可能未意识到的)指令工作。 公式中包含了返回空文本("")的运算,而后续计算将空文本当作0处理,也是常见情况。例如,公式“=IF(A1>10, A1, "")”在A1不大于10时会返回空文本。如果另一个单元格用公式“=B12”引用这个结果(B1是上面的公式单元格),那么空文本在算术运算中会被视为0,导致结果为0。您可以使用“ISNUMBER”或“LEN”函数先判断单元格内容是否为有效数字。 Excel的“显示精度”设置也可能造成视觉上的0结果。在“文件”->“选项”->“高级”中,有一项“将精度设为所显示的精度”。如果勾选此项,Excel会永久地将单元格中的数值四舍五入到其所显示的小数位数。例如,一个实际值为0.001的单元格,如果格式设置为显示0位小数,那么它不仅显示为0,其存储值也会被改为0,所有后续基于此值的计算都将基于0进行。除非必要,通常不建议勾选此选项。 对于涉及除法运算的公式,如果除数为0,Excel会直接返回“DIV/0!”错误。但有时,除数可能是一个结果为0的表达式,或者引用了一个看似非零但实际计算后为0的单元格,这时就需要仔细检查除数部分的公式逻辑。您可以使用“IFERROR”函数来捕获这种错误,并返回一个更友好的提示,例如“=IFERROR(A1/B1, "除数无效")”。 使用“&”符号进行文本连接时,如果连接的成分中包含数字0,它会被作为文本“0”连接进去,这通常不会引起混淆。但如果在算术运算后试图连接一个结果为0的数值,可能需要使用“TEXT”函数来格式化输出,以免结果看起来像数字0。例如,“= "结果是:" & TEXT(A1+B1, "0")”。 最后,一个综合性的排查步骤是使用Excel的“公式审核”工具。在“公式”选项卡下,使用“显示公式”快捷键(通常是Ctrl+`,即重音符键),可以切换显示所有单元格中的公式本身,而非结果。这有助于快速发现哪些单元格显示的是0结果,但其公式可能很长很复杂。您还可以使用“追踪引用单元格”和“追踪从属单元格”功能,用箭头图形化展示公式的引用关系,从而理清数据流向,找到导致0结果的源头单元格。 面对“excel公式显示0显示结果”的疑问,系统性的诊断思维至关重要。不要被表面的0所迷惑,它更像是Excel给出的一句“计算结果为零”的陈述。从检查原始数据有效性开始,逐步确认单元格格式、计算选项、函数参数与逻辑、引用完整性以及软件的特殊设置,绝大多数情况下您都能找到症结所在,并让公式重新焕发生机,准确呈现出您期望的计算成果。掌握这些排查技巧,您将能更加从容地驾驭Excel,让数据真正为您所用。 总而言之,Excel公式显示0而非预期结果,是一个涉及数据、格式、设置、逻辑等多层面的综合现象。通过本文提供的从简到繁、由表及里的排查路径,您已经拥有了解决此问题的完整工具箱。记住,耐心和细心是数据分析师最好的伙伴,下次再遇到那个沉默的“0”时,不妨带着这些方法,一步步揭开它背后的数据真相。
推荐文章
要解决excel公式计算怎么填充一整列的数据这一问题,核心方法是使用Excel的“填充柄”功能、应用“填充”命令,或借助“表格”特性与数组公式,以实现公式在整列中的快速、准确复制与自动计算。
2026-03-08 01:44:49
83人看过
当Excel公式计算结果为零却显示乱码时,通常是由于单元格格式设置错误、隐藏字符干扰或公式引用异常所致,只需调整数字格式、清理数据源或检查函数逻辑即可恢复正常显示。本文将系统解析excel公式结果是0时为何显示乱码了呢的各类成因,并提供十几种针对性解决方案,帮助用户彻底解决这一常见数据呈现问题。
2026-03-08 01:44:01
258人看过
在Excel中,若需通过公式计算保留两位小数,核心方法是结合四舍五入函数或设置单元格格式,确保计算结果既精确又整洁,这能有效提升数据可读性与规范性,满足日常报表或财务处理需求,本文将从多个层面详细解析如何实现这一目标。
2026-03-08 01:43:33
96人看过
用户询问“excel公式计算过程”,其核心需求是希望系统地理解并掌握在Excel(电子表格)中,从公式的输入、构成元素、运算逻辑到错误排查的完整工作流程与底层原理,从而能够自主构建和优化计算公式来解决实际数据处理问题。
2026-03-08 01:42:31
214人看过
.webp)
.webp)
.webp)
.webp)